I was 21 the last time I stepped foot in The Netherlands – or should I say, Amsterdam. I went there for a long weekend with my boyfriend at the time, and we spent three days exploring the city – from its infamous coffee shops to quaint neighbourhoods and an unplanned visit to the red-light district. I have fond memories of that weekend, and I was left with the desire to return and visit more of The Netherlands. It took a quarter of a century, but I finally made it there again :D.

I did not go to Amsterdam this time around; instead, I discovered The Netherlands for the beautiful and lush country that it is. I toured the picturesque town of Woerden and The city of The Hague on the national mode of transportation: a proper Dutch bicycle, I cruised the canals of Gouda on a boat and was kindly treated to a slice of Dutch life by locals. Once again, my heart is full of gratitude for the opportunity to continuously travel and discover the endless beauty of this world.
